Gene Therapy Extends Mouse Lifespan 182
Grond writes "ScienceDaily reports, 'Researchers at the Spanish National Cancer Research Centre have demonstrated that the mouse lifespan can be extended by the application in adult life of a single treatment acting directly on the animal's genes. Mice treated at the age of one lived longer by 24% on average (PDF), and those treated at the age of two, by 13%. The therapy, furthermore, produced an appreciable improvement in the animals' health, delaying the onset of age-related diseases — like osteoporosis and insulin resistance — and achieving improved readings on aging indicators like neuromuscular coordination.' Notably, the therapy did not cause an increase in the incidence of cancer."

The Harvard researchers didn't use gene therapy to lengthen the telomeres. They engineered a knock-in allele encoding a 4-hydroxytamoxifen (4-OHT)-inducible telomerase reverse transcriptase-Estrogen Receptor (TERT-ER) under transcriptional control of the endogenous TERT promoter. Basically, the mice had short telomeres and the researchers could reactivate telomerase by administering 4-OHT. That's genetic engineering, not gene therapy in adult mice.
Furthermore, the Harvard researchers showed the reversal of artificially-induced aging, but not an increase in lifespan. The researchers in this study demonstrated an increase in lifespan in normal mice.
The Harvard study showed that improving telomerase activity could reverse or slow aging, but it didn't show how to actually accomplish this in normal, adult organisms. That's what the researchers in this study have done, at least in mice.
